  • Abstract
    Red hilly area of south China is the most important agricultural production base of China, where account for about 1/5 of land area of China, 40% population of China and 30% of arable land. Besides, it provides food for nearly half of the population. So it is important theoretical and practical significance for research about soil fertility and agrarian capability in this area. Taking the typical hilly red soil region of south China, Longhui County as the research area, this research did spatial analyses about farmland fertility evaluation factors by choosing suitable affected factors and reasonable evaluation method. It analyses space distribution character of farmland fertility evaluation factors, and its affection to farmland fertility evaluation. Using spatial and overlap analyses based on GIS, this research made spatial variability that affect farmland fertility and its spatial distribution to informatization, and discuss the development of farmland fertility and its affected factors in hilly red soil region of south China from spatial dimension.
